Course overview
To develop students' knowledge of the dynamics of Australian society and cultures, and an appreciation of the processes of continuity and change through the development of students' research and critical analysis capabilities.
Course learning outcomes
- Demonstrate a comprehensive awareness of specific events, personalities, terminology and values to be found in Australian society.
- Comprehend the development of Australia in terms of its complexity and the interaction of various factors and actors.
- Apply theories and methodologies to an understanding of a range of themes in Australian society.
- Critically appreciate the various social, economic and cultural positions of Australians.
- Understand and evaluate judgements made about Australian society, and debate their validity.
